WebAn incentive spirometer is made of hollow, clear plastic. It has a tube with a mouthpiece attached. There are two indicators that show: 1. How deeply your child breathes in. A grid with numbers on the main chamber measures how much air your child is breathing in. Accumulation of mucus and sputum restricts air from freely flowing into and out of the lungs. This contributes to wheezing, coughing, and shortness of breath in obstructive lung diseases such as chronic bronchitis and emphysema. 1 .
